Job Title: Research Coordinator
Grade: 14
Salary: $26,376.50-$31,583.50
The Research Foundation for Mental Hygiene, Inc. is seeking to hire a part-time Research Coordinator who will be primarily responsible for assisting in the coordination of all research activities for various clinical trials and observational studies within the Division of Geriatric Psychiatry. These studies are focused on patients with Alzheimer's disease and patients with mild cognitive impairment who are at elevated risk for decline to dementia.
Candidates must be willing to complete a phlebotomy certification course and perform blood-draws. Must be certified in phlebotomy or obtain certification before drawing any blood samples.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
1) Assisting in the coordination and implementation of all protocols assigned, including accountabilities such as: scheduling study assessments/procedures and participant interviews; organizing participant source documents, chart and study specific materials; ordering supplies; coordinating and accompanying participants to procedures (MRI, PET)
2) Administration of neuropsychological tests and symptom rating scales
3) Participant recruitment
4) Data entry and management
5) Biospecimen collection and processing (blood and CSF)
6) Completion of regulatory submissions for the NYSPI IRB
7) Ability to communicate effectively within a large cross functional study team
Minimum Qualifications:
- A Bachelor of Arts/ Bachelor of Science
Preferred Qualifications:
- 1-2 years of previous experience working in clinical research preferred
